What is a data analyst student?

A Data Analyst Student job is typically an internship or entry-level role designed for students who are learning data analysis. In this role, you assist with gathering, cleaning, and analyzing data to support business decisions. You may work with tools like Excel, SQL, Python, or visualization software to create reports and insights. This position helps build practical experience and develop analytical skills for a future career as a Data Analyst.

What types of projects or tasks can a data analyst student expect to work on during an internship or entry-level position?

As a Data Analyst Student, you can expect to assist with tasks such as cleaning and preparing datasets, conducting basic data analyses, and creating visualizations to help interpret trends. You may also support more senior data analysts with research, reporting, or automating routine data processes. These responsibilities offer practical exposure to real-world data challenges and foster collaboration with cross-functional teams, such as marketing or finance. This hands-on experience not only sharpens your technical abilities but also enhances your problem-solving and communication skills, preparing you for advanced roles in data analytics.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the data analyst student position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Data Analyst Student, you need a solid understanding of statistics, data interpretation, and foundational programming skills, often supported by coursework in mathematics, computer science, or related fields. Familiarity with tools such as Microsoft Excel, SQL, Python, or R as well as data visualization platforms like Tableau is highly adv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ills make candidates stand out when translating complex data into actionable insights. These competencies are crucial for accurately analyzing information, presenting findings, and contributing meaningfully to data-driven projects.

Can a non-IT student become a data analyst?

Yes, a non-IT student can become a data analyst by developing skills in data analysis tools like Excel, SQL, and Python, and gaining knowledge of statistics and data visualization. Many employers value analytical thinking and domain knowledge, and relevant certifications can help bridge the gap in technical skills.

Job description

Role Overview

LaunchEd is an innovation platform that helps education companies prove the real-world impact of their products through independent research and evidence-based validation. We partner with promising edtech companies, evaluate their effectiveness, and use those insights to support investment, growth, and go-to-market decisions.

As the Data Analyst Researcher, you'll build and deliver the research behind those decisions. You'll design studies, analyze quantitative data, measure product efficacy and return on investment (ROI), and produce clear, defensible findings that help determine whether products are creating meaningful outcomes for schools, educators, and students.

This role is ideal for someone who enjoys statistical analysis, research design, and using data to answer important business and educational questions.

Key Responsibilities

Efficacy & ROI Evaluation

• Baseline statistical benchmarks at intake and track them throughout program participation, from

intake to graduation.

• Design and run studies measuring product impact on student and operational outcomes.

• Quantify return on investment for companies and products across the LaunchEd portfolio.

• Produce independent, evidence-based evaluations that hold up to outside scrutiny.

• Produce efficacy and ROI reports on LaunchEd clients that are benchmarked against comparable

external data.

• Collaborate with higher-education and university partners to pursue university-sanctioned

research.

The LaunchEd Validation Score

• Develop and maintain the LaunchEd Validation Score as a core piece of platform IP.

• Establish a consistent, defensible methodology that can serve as a credible market standard for

edtech validation.

• Translate study findings into the standardized LaunchEd Validation Report.

In-House Study Capacity

• Deliver multiple efficacy and ROI studies per year as a repeatable in-house capability.

• Reduce reliance on external efficacy and validation vendors.

Cross-Department Support

• Provide research and analysis support across LaunchEd teams, including network grading and

accreditation.

• Partner with the deal team to feed validated outcomes into Gate 2 reviews and Investment

Committee decisions.

Requirements

• Strong quantitative and statistical analysis skills, with the ability to design and run studies

independently.

• Experience measuring efficacy, outcomes, or return on investment, ideally in education or a

related field.

• Ability to build clear, defensible methodologies and translate data into decision-ready findings.

• Familiarity with education data, student outcomes, and relevant compliance considerations such

as FERPA and COPPA is a plus.

• Proficiency with data analysis tools such as Excel, SQL, and Python or R, and clear data

visualization.

• Detail orientation, independence, and discretion handling confidential company and student data.

• Alignment with LaunchEd’s mission and the Strong Minds, Good Hearts ethos.
